Middleton Hall Care Home, located at 205/207 Grimshaw Lane, is a distinguished residential facility offering both long-term and short-term care for up to 29 residents. Specialising in dementia and older person care, the home is dedicated to providing compassionate and personalised support.

Residents and their families consistently praise the home for its warm and welcoming atmosphere. One reviewer notes, "The home is very clean, a friendly atmosphere, would highly recommend Middleton Hall Care Home." Another shares, "The staff are amazing always taking the time to talk to both residents and visitors they are caring and always have a smile."

The facility offers 27 single rooms and 2 companion rooms, allowing residents to personalise their spaces with their own furniture if desired. Amenities include a lift, stairlift, wheelchair access, and internet connectivity, ensuring comfort and accessibility for all. The home also boasts a garden for residents to enjoy outdoor activities.

Managed by Christopher Hayes , Middleton Hall Care Home has achieved an impressive review score. This high rating reflects the exceptional care and dedication of the staff, as echoed by a family member: "The staff are true professionals and genuinely care about the residents, and relatives."

With a commitment to dignity, respect, and a homely environment, Middleton Hall Care Home stands as a beacon of quality care in the community.

Overview of Review Score

The Review Score of 9.9 (9.907) out of 10 for Middleton Hall Care Home is based on a) the Average Rating and b) the number of positive Reviews.

  • a) The Average Rating is 4.9 out of 5 from 17 Reviews in the last 24 months.

  • b) The score for the number of positive Reviews is 5.0 out of 5 from 17 positive Reviews in the last 24 months.

Detailed Breakdown of Review Score

The maximum Review Score for a Care Home is 10, which is made up from the Average Rating of Reviews (maximum of 5 points) and the Number of Reviews (maximum of 5 points) in the last 24 months:

  • a) 5 Points are available for the Average Rating from all Reviews in the last 24 months.

    The Average Rating of 4.907 for Middleton Hall Care Home is calculated as follows: ( (187 Excellents x 5) + (15 Goods x 4) + (2 Satisfactorys x 3) ) ÷ 204 Ratings = 4.907

  • b) 5 Points are available for the number of Positive Reviews in the last 24 months. A Positive Review is defined as any Review with an 'Overall Experience' of '4' or '5' (out of a max rating '5').

    The 5 Points relating to the number of positive Reviews for Middleton Hall Care Home is based on 17 positive Reviews in the last 24 months and is calculated as per below:

    The 5 points available are broken down as follows:

    • i) 4 points are available for the first 10 Positive Reviews in the last 24 months; 3 points for the first Positive Review, and then 0.125 Points for each of the next four Positive Reviews and then 0.1 Points for the next five Positive Reviews. (1st = 3.000, 2nd = 0.125, 3rd = 0.125, 4th = 0.125, 5th = 0.125, 6th = 0.100, 7th = 0.100, 8th = 0.100, 9th = 0.100, 10th = 0.100) 3 + 0.125 + 0.125 + 0.125 + 0.125 + 0.1 + 0.1 + 0.1 + 0.1 + 0.1 = 4

    • ii) 1 point is available for the number of Positive Reviews reaching 20% of the registered maximum number of service users in the last 24 months. If this number is partially reached, then that proportion of 1 point is given. eg a Care Home registered for a maximum of 50 service users has to reach 10 Positive Reviews to receive 1 point, if it has 7 reviews it will receive 0.7 points. 20% of the 29 registered maximum number of service users is 5.8, which has been reached with 17 Positive reviews. Points = 1

  • When a Review is submitted by someone who has previously submitted a Review, only the latest Review will count towards the Review Score.

  • If a Care Home does not have a review in the last 24 months, then it will not have a Review Score.
